Specifications
63mm (63-485 neck finish) black dual door flapper cap (sift & spoon) with a HIS (heat induction liner) for PET and PVC. This polypropylene (PP) plastic cap features two snap closures - one side has a wide slot for spoons or pouring, and one side has 7 holes (.200") for controlled dispensing. This closure is a popular option for dry food ingredients such as herbs and spices. Induction liners are a popular choice when a tamper evident air tight seal is needed. These liners are suitable for pharmaceutical, food, and liquid products.

Key benefits
  • Controlled access
  • Easy-to-open one step dispensing
  • Audible "snap" ensures freshness and security
  • One-piece design with no detached parts
  • Unique thumb detail provides ease of opening
  • Special cleanout rings prevent material from sifting through closed lid

Material:

Polypropylene PlasticPolypropylene (PP) is a tough plastic that has excellent chemical resistance. PP is translucent in its natural state but can have a glossy finish when produced with color. Some examples of common products made with PP are dairy and medication containers. Polypropylene is suitable for hot fill applications of up to 205°F and is therefore great for autoclaving. It is not recommended for cold or sub-freezing temperatures. What’s the difference between a flapper cap and a spice cap?
Spice caps are lids without holes. These caps often have a plastic band with holes that snaps onto the neck of the container for dispensing. Flapper caps feature a snap opening with slotted openings for dispensing.
What applications are commonly used with spice caps?
In addition to spices and herbs, these caps commonly store powdered applications for gardening, cleaning and industrial industries.
